概述

  • Bandwidth: 8GHz min
  • Input Noise Current Density: 12 pA/ root Hz
  • Differential Trans-impedance: 2 kΩ and 5 kΩ Options
  • Power Dissipation: 150 mW
  • Differential Output Swing: 400mV pk-pk
  • Input Overload: +3.25 dBm @ 10 dB ER
  • Low-F cutoff: 25 kHz w/CLF=0.5nF
  • Optional On-Chip PD filter: RF=200 Ω, CF=20 pF
  • Die Size: : 0.65mm x 1.20mm

The ADN2821 is a 10 Gbps high-performance SiGe Transimpedance Amplifier specifically designed for use in small form factor optical receivers. The ADN2821 series features low input referred noise current and a range of trans-impedance gains. 8GHz minimum bandwidth enables up to 11.1 Gbps operation; 1.1uA input referred noise current enables –19dBm sensitivity; +3.25dBm nominal operation at 10dB extinction ratio. For assembly in small form factor packages, the ADN2821 series integrates a photodiode filter RFCF network on-chip and features 25kHz low frequency cutoff with small 0.5nF external capacitor. The ADN2821 operates with a 3.3V ± 0.3V power supply and is available in die form.

Applications

  • Up to 11.1 Gbps Optical Modules
  • SONET/SDH OC-192/STM-64 and 10 GbE Receivers, Transceivers, Transponders
